Since 1996 it has been a legal requirement to take and pass a Driving Theory Test before being allowed to make an appointment for a Practical Driving Test. The PC-based Test takes place at three sites around Kent, in Sidcup, Chatham and Canterbury and is in two parts.
The first consists of 50 multiple-choice questions, then secondly a Hazard Perception section which tests the candidate's ability to spot when hazards develop, reacting to the situation with the click of a mouse or a tap of the space bar.

The Practical Driving Test has in recent years been improved to take into account the extra traffic on the roads, with the subsequent rising number of accidents and deaths leading the Government to introduce further initiatives to make the roads safer. The Test usually lasts around 38-40 minutes though it may take more time as they follow a set route, so depending on traffic conditions it may take longer.
